Following on from this question I now have code that can attach to a process using the Mdbg API.

The problem is that I can't detach from the process if I need to. When I call mgProcess.Detach().WaitOne(); ( where mgProcess is a MDbgProcess created from an MDbgEngine object ) I get the following error message:

 Process not synchronized. (Exception from HRESULT: 0x80131302)
     at Microsoft.Samples.Debugging.CorDebug.NativeApi.ICorDebugController.Detach()
     at Microsoft.Samples.Debugging.CorDebug.CorController.Detach() in C:\mdbg\src\debugger\corapi\Controller.cs:line 89
     at Microsoft.Samples.Debugging.MdbgEngine.MDbgProcess.Detach() in C:\mdbg\src\debugger\mdbgeng\Process.cs:line 716

If I just try to call mgProcess.Detach() or mgProcess.CorProcess.Detach() I get the same result.

Does anyone know the correct way to detach an Mdbg process?

Solution

It transpires that Mdbg will not allow you to do anything while the debugee is running.

  MgProcess.CorProcess.Stop(0);
  MgProcess.Detach();

Appears to be the way forward.

OTHER TIPS

Try this:

proc.AsyncStop();
proc.Detach();

or

Proc.CorProcess.Stop(0);  
Proc.Detach();
